Subject: Re: [PATCH v2 for-4.6] libxl: handle read-only drives with qemu-xen
Date: Mon, 21 Sep 2015 12:53:48 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1442836428.10338.58.camel@citrix.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<22008.17873.704727.417727@mariner.uk.xensource.com>

On Tue, 2015-09-15 at 17:22 +0100, Ian Jackson wrote:
> Stefano Stabellini writes ("[PATCH v2 for-4.6] libxl: handle read-only
> drives with qemu-xen"):
> > The current libxl code doesn't deal with read-only drives at all.
> > 
> > Upstream QEMU and qemu-xen only support read-only cdrom drives: make
> > sure to specify "readonly=on" for cdrom drives and return error in case
> > the user requested a non-cdrom read-only drive.
> 
> Acked-by: Ian Jackson <ian.jackson@eu.citrix.com>

I applied to staging and staging-4.6 with this Ack and Wei's say so
elsewhere.
